Current forecast models project a daily high of 32–33°C for Guangzhou on September 10, driven by partly cloudy skies, northeasterly winds of 4–6 m/s, and a 60–70% chance of thunderstorms that limit afternoon heating. This aligns with the 1991–2020 climatological average high of 32.4°C and recent model runs showing minimal deviation. Trader consensus, reflected in the 54.5% implied probability for 33°C versus 21% for 32°C and 20% for 34°C, incorporates uncertainty around exact convective timing and any late-day clearing that could allow a brief spike. Official China Meteorological Administration observations at the primary station will resolve the market based on the verified maximum.

The resolution source for this market will be information from NOAA, specifically the highest reading under the "Temp" column for all times on this day, available here: https://www.weather.gov/wrh/timeseries?site=zggg
If NOAA data for the observation date is unavailable by 11:59 PM ET on the day following the observation date, the Weather Underground Daily Observations table will be used as the resolution source.
In the event that there is no data for the observation date by 11:59 PM ET on the day following the observation date, this market will resolve to the lowest bracket.
To toggle between Fahrenheit and Celsius, click the "Switch to Metric Units" button until the relevant table displays °C.
This market will resolve once the first data point for the following date has been published on the resolution source, or by 11:59 PM ET on the day following the observation date, whichever comes first.
The resolution source for this market measures temperatures to whole degrees Celsius (eg, 9°C). Thus, this is the level of precision that will be used when resolving the market.
Revisions to temperatures recorded within this market's timeframe will be considered until the first datapoint for the following date has been published, after which any alterations will not be considered.
